if y varies inversely with x and the constant of variation is 4.5 what are the values missing in the table
Alexxandr [17]
Seems like you forgot to attach the table.
For this reason, I will explain how to solve this question and you can apply using the numbers in your table.

We are given that:
y is inversely proportion to x. This means that as y decreases, x increases and vice versa.
Writing this into equation, we would get:
y = c/x where c is the constant of proportionality.
Now, we have the constant of proportionality given as 4.5.
This means that the equation that relates x and y is:
y = (4.5) / x

So, to fill in the table, we would substitute with the given x or y in the equation above and solve for the other variable.

Examples:
If given that x=2, then:
y = (4.5) / (2) = 2.25
If given that y=3, then:
3 = (4.5) / x
x = (4.5) / (3) = 1.5
